Commuting from SE15

Good · 25–35 min

Door-to-door TfL Journey Planner times from the representative postcode, arriving by 08:15 on a fixed weekday.

  • Waterloo35 min
  • King's Cross42 min
  • Liverpool Street37 min
  • Canary Wharf34 min
  • Paddington49 min
  • Victoria34 min
Council tax

Council Tax in SE15 (Band D)

Annual bill incl. GLA precept, 2025/26. Where SE15 straddles boroughs, every touching authority is listed.

  • Southwark£1,932
  • Lewisham£2,272
